Graco Total Assets 2010-2025 | GGG

Graco total assets from 2010 to 2025. Total assets can be defined as the sum of all assets on a company's balance sheet.
  • Graco total assets for the quarter ending March 31, 2025 were $3.008B, a 7.95% increase year-over-year.
  • Graco total assets for 2024 were $3.139B, a 15.33% increase from 2023.
  • Graco total assets for 2023 were $2.722B, a 11.61% increase from 2022.
  • Graco total assets for 2022 were $2.439B, a 0.18% decline from 2021.

Graco Inc. engages in designing, manufacturing and marketing equipment and systems used to measure, move, control, spray and dispense fluid as well as powder materials. The products offered by the company are produced in the United States, Italy, the U.K., Belgium, Switzerland, China and Romania. The products are mainly sold through the company's authorized distribution centers to customers in Asia Pacific, North, Central and South America (the Americas), and Europe, Middle East and Africa (EMEA). The company provides valves, pumps, accessories, and meters to dispense and move chemicals, wastewater, oil and natural gas, petroleum, lubricants, food and other fluids under this segment. End-markets served include service garages, food and beverage, fleet service centers, dairy, pharmaceutical, oil and natural gas, semiconductor, cosmetics, industrial lubrication, electronics, fast oil change facilities, mining, wastewater, automobile dealerships and others.
